Smoke Alarms are mandatory in many states and territories. Residential smoke alarms are life-saving devices that sense the presence of smoke in the home and alert the occupants, giving time to escape. Smoke alarms are designed to detect fire smoke and emit a loud and distinctive sound to alert occupants of potential danger. Celebrate Our Fantastic Forests Australia was covered with approximately 226 million hectares of native forests before European settlement. Now about 164 million hectares (21 per cent of the total area of Australia) is covered in forests. Learn about forests and the various types of forests in Australia: indigenous or native forests; plantation forests; eucalypt (hardwood) plantations; urban forests. The Duyfken Voyage:1606-2006 Investigate our martime history and see what happened with this small Dutch ship in 1606. A replica of the Duyfken has been built and is sailing around the southern and eastern coasts making calls along the route. Experience first hand, track the current voyage and investigate with these great lesson ideas.
